How expensive is the 2023 Honda CR-V Hybrid?

In terms of cost, the 2023 CR-V Hybrid has an MSRP of $31,110. In comparison, the 2022 Toyota RAV4 Hybrid starts at $29,575. But, the RAV4 is an older vehicle. Honda has fully updated the CR-V for the 2023 model year. 

A blue 2023 Honda CR-V Hybrid small SUV is driving on the road.
The 2023 Honda CR-V Hybrid | Honda

The new CR-V Hybrid is currently available in two trim levels. These include the EX and the EX-L, with the EX-L costing about $34k. Each model comes with a turbocharged engine that makes 190 horsepower and 179 pound-foot of torque. Plus, you get the benefits of a hybrid system for better fuel economy. 

What’s new about the CR-V Hybrid?

For 2023, Honda has increased the power and efficiency of the CR-V Hybrid. And that makes this a hybrid SUV that is worthy of consideration. The interior has been updated to modern Honda design language, similar to that of the Honda Civic. Speaking of the interior, the cabin feels more spacious as well. Which means more room for cargo and passengers.

The exterior looks more aggressive as well. And although most folks probably won’t take the CR-V Hybrid on serious adventures, it certainly does look the part. A range of safety features are now standard. Including things like adaptive cruise control, lane-keep assist, and blind-spot monitoring. And that could make this hybrid SUV ideal for those with families. 

Does the CR-V Hybrid have a spare tire?

Unfortunately, it seems most manufacturers are moving away from offering spare tires. With this SUV, you will get a simple fix-a-flat system. Which is not as ideal as being able to change your tire if you get a flat.
